After the first mile the trail leads to a rocky wash which takes hikers to an impressive natural rock staircase leading to a "hallway" formed by steep canyon walls. The wash portion of the route requires the hiker to scramble over large boulders and other debris. This route offers spectacular views of geologic formations, steep canyon walls, tall trees, and mountaintops. NO PETS ALLOWEDIMPORTANT: Much of this route crosses loose rock and a boulder-filled wash, with some scrambling required.
